Good things to know
Which word is more common?
Regularly is more commonly used than habitually in everyday language. Regularly is versatile and covers a wide range of contexts, while habitually is less common and tends to be used in more specific situations.
What’s the difference in the tone of formality between habitually and regularly?
Both habitually and regularly can be used in formal and informal contexts, but habitually may be perceived as more formal due to its less common usage.
